Course Description
AutoCAD for chemical engineers course,
in this course you'll delve into the essentials of AutoCAD, honing skills vital for precise design and visualization in the realm of chemical engineering. Starting with the basics, you'll explore the interface and commands specific to chemical process design, mastering techniques for drafting P&IDs, equipment layouts, and plant designs. Through practical exercises and real-world examples, you'll grasp how AutoCAD streamlines tasks unique to chemical engineering projects, empowering you to create accurate and efficient designs effectively. Whether you're a novice or seasoned professional, this course equips you with the proficiency needed to navigate AutoCAD proficiently within the context of chemical engineering applications.
